Subject: Re: [PATCH net-next] net/sched: simplify tc_action_load_ops
 parameters

Thu, Jan 04, 2024 at 03:11:13PM CET, pctammela@...atatu.com wrote:
>Instead of using two bools derived from a flags passed as arguments to
>the parent function of tc_action_load_ops, just pass the flags itself
>to tc_action_load_ops to simplify its parameters.
>
>Signed-off-by: Pedro Tammela <pctammela@...atatu.com>
>---
> include/net/act_api.h | 3 +--
> net/sched/act_api.c   | 9 ++++-----
> net/sched/cls_api.c   | 5 ++---
> 3 files changed, 7 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)
